数据库SQL模拟试题与解答

需积分: 10 4 下载量 65 浏览量 更新于2024-10-01 收藏 46KB DOC 举报
“数据库SQL模拟试题.doc 是一份针对计算机考试的文档,包含数据库SQL相关的选择题,涉及关系模型、数据库连接认证方式、SQL Server 2000的安装注意事项、主键概念及其创建、以及表和索引的作用。” 本文将详细阐述数据库SQL模拟试题中涉及到的关键知识点: 1. **关系模型**: 关系模型是数据库系统中最常用的数据模型之一,它以二维表格的形式存储数据,强调数据之间的关系。关系模型中,每个表格称为一个关系,行代表记录,列代表属性。关系模型支持一对一、一对多和多对多的关系,并且要求在关系表中不存在重复行。 2. **数据库连接认证**: 数据库连接通常有两种认证方式:Windows身份验证和SQL Server身份验证。Windows身份验证利用操作系统的用户账户进行身份验证,而SQL Server身份验证则需要在连接时提供特定的用户名和密码。 3. **SQL Server 2000的安装注意事项**: 安装SQL Server 2000时需注意,尤其是在Windows NT Server 4.0上,至少需要安装Service Pack 4或更高版本。此外,尽管对硬件有一定的推荐配置,但并不意味着没有限制。SQL Server 2000的安装可能还需要启用TCP/IP等网络协议。 4. **主键**: 主键是关系数据库中的关键概念,用于唯一标识表中的每一条记录。创建主键有多种方法,包括在创建表时指定主键约束或之后通过ALTER TABLE语句添加。在提供的选项中,主键应该是标识表中唯一的实体,不允许为空值,且每个表只能有一个主键。 5. **表与索引**: 表是数据库中用于存放各种数据内容的基本单元。创建表可以通过数据库管理工具(如企业管理器)或使用SQL语句(如CREATE TABLE)完成。索引的创建是为了提高查询效率,它可以加快数据检索速度,但会占用额外的存储空间。 6. **索引的目的**: 为数据表创建索引的主要目的是为了优化查询性能。索引能够快速定位到数据,使得数据访问更快。然而,索引并不是所有情况下都适用,因为它们会增加数据更新的复杂性和存储开销。 这些知识点涵盖了数据库基础、SQL Server的操作以及数据库设计的核心概念,对于准备计算机考试,尤其是数据库相关部分的考生来说,是非常有价值的参考资料。通过解答这些问题,考生可以检验自己的理论知识和实践技能,进一步提升对数据库管理和SQL语言的理解。